Late Drama in Italy as Paris Giants Edge Past Premier League Rivals

Paris Saint Germain claimed the Super cup crown on Wednesday night defeating Tottenham Hotspur 4 - 3 on penalties after tense 2 - 2 draw at Stadio Friuli in Italy.
Tottenham took the lead in the 39 minute when Micky van de Ven pounced on loose clearance firing into the top corner from close range. Cristian Romero doubled the advantage early in the 2nd half heading home from set piece in the 48 minute.
PSG pulled one back through Lee Kang in in the 85 minute with powerful strike from outside the box. Deep into stoppage time, Ousmane Dembele delivered pinpoint cross for Goncalo Ramos whose header made it 2 - 2 and forced penalties.
In the shootout PSG held their nerve converting four of their spot kicks to Tottenham’s three sealing memorable victory and adding another European trophy to their collection.
